Possibly the simplest and most elegant approach is the method of momentum exchange by tethers, from Tethers Unlimited.

This could be built fairly easily, possibly cheaper than building a mass driver on the Moon.

http://www.tethers.com/papers/CislunarAIAAPaper.pdf

It has an advantage over mass driver in that it can be used to soft land on the Moon as well as depart from the Moon.
If the energy imparted by the cargo is balanced, the tether would require little if any energy input and minimal propellant usage
